The Snowy Day wins hearts with its beautiful, quiet storytelling and the charming adventure of a little boy in the snow. It's a groundbreaking book that captures the essence of childhood wonder, appealing especially to fans who love its gentle pace and memorable illustrations.
Fans are really digging Green Eggs and Ham for its playful, repetitive rhymes and its universally appealing message about trying new things. It's a book that many have a strong nostalgic connection to, making it a frontrunner in fan votes.
